Primary energy from fossil fuels, nuclear, and renewables in Czechia
Czechia: Primary energy from fossil fuels, nuclear, and renewables was 23.1% in 2025. β Volatile
Primary energy from fossil fuels, nuclear, and renewables in Czechia, 1965β2025
Source: Energy Institute - Statistical Review of World Energy (2026); Smil (2017); U.S. Energy Information Administration (2026) β with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in %.
Analysis
Czechia recorded 23.1% for primary energy from fossil fuels, nuclear, and renewables in 2025. That is the highest value across all 61 years on record.
That represents a change of up 5.0% on the previous year and up 34.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, primary energy from fossil fuels, nuclear, and renewables in Czechia peaked at 23.1%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 1965.
Czechia ranks 8th of 215 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
